Функция ОСТАТ() в EXCEL

history

Функция ОСТАТ() , английский вариант MOD(), возвращает остаток от деления аргумента «число» на значение аргумента «делитель». Результат имеет тот же знак, что и делитель.


Синтаксис функции

ОСТАТ ( число ; делитель )

Число — число, остаток от деления которого определяется.

Делитель — число, на которое нужно разделить (делитель).

Если делитель равен 0, функция ОСТАТ() возвращает значение ошибки #ДЕЛ/0!

ПРИМЕРЫ



=ОСТАТ(10; 2) Остаток от деления 10/2 (0)

=ОСТАТ(3; 2) Остаток от деления 3/2 (1)

=ОСТАТ(-3; 2) Остаток от деления -3/2. Знак тот же, что и у делителя (1)

Если делитель равен 1, функция ОСТАТ() возвращает дробную часть положительного числа =ОСТАТ(3,56;1) Вернет 0,56

Если число отрицательное, то для нахождения дробной части числа, нужно записать формулу =ОСТАТ(-3,56;-1) , которая вернет -0,56.

Универсальная формула для выделения дробной части числа, находящегося в ячейке А1 : =ОСТАТ(A1;ЕСЛИ(A1<0;-1;1))

Связь между функциями ЦЕЛОЕ() и ОСТАТ()

Функция ОСТАТ() может быть выражена через функцию ЦЕЛОЕ() . Например, для числа 10 и делителя 3: =ОСТАТ(10;3) = 10 - 3*ЦЕЛОЕ(10/3)

обратное выражение =ЦЕЛОЕ(10/3)=(ОСТАТ(10;3)-10)/-3


Комментарии

Только для авторизованных пользователей

(только для авторизованных пользователей)

© Copyright 2013 - 2024 Excel2.ru. All Rights Reserved